Suitcases fit for a queen

If you’ve already booked your break to exotic shores for summer 2014, then prepare to travel in style with the opening of a new, luxury suitcases and luggage boutique in Mayfair.

Great British holiday.

The Queen’s luggage maker, British brand Globe-Trotter, will be opening a new boutique at 35 Albemarle Street next year, relocating from their current, rather small premises in Burlington Arcade. The new store will be double the size of their existing shop and will feature a VIP area for wealthy customers looking to design bespoke items.

Traditional manufacturing.

Globe-Trotter’s luggage is made using vulcanized fibre, which is a paper-based material first used in the UK in 1859, and the brand has also expanded to create leather goods. Expect queues a-plenty and celebrity spotting during the opening week, as Daniel Craig, Dita Von Teese and Kate Moss are all fans of this luxury travel brand.

Gallic luxury.

Luxury luggage brands seem to be popping up all over Mayfair this year, as Moynat, a renowned French company, will be opening a new store on Mount Street in the run-up to Christmas, and Goyard already has a boutique on Mount Street in Mayfair.
